Drying and Dehumidification

After the water is gone, we start the drying process. We use air movers and dehumidifiers to remove moisture from the air and surfaces. We monitor humidity levels to make sure everything dries properly. This step can take 3-5 days depending on the size of the area. It’s important to do it thoroughly. We check progress daily to avoid mold growth. We use advanced equipment to speed up the drying process. Your home will be back to normal faster than you think.

Unusual Sounds From The Toilet

Strange noises from your toilet are a red flag. Gurgling, hissing, or bubbling sounds mean something is wrong. These sounds can show a blockage or a leak. We can find the source and fix it before it gets worse. It’s not just about the noise, it’s about the damage it could cause. We handle these issues with care and expertise. Water Leaking From The Base Of The Toilet

Water pooling around the base of your toilet is a sign of a serious problem. It could mean a cracked tank or a faulty seal. This water can damage your floor and walls. We can find the source and fix it quickly. It’s important to act fast before the damage spreads. We use tools to check for leaks and repair them. Toilet Overflow Water Removal vs. DIY: When To Call A Professional

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
Small puddle near the toilet Yes No It’s easy to clean up but hard to find the source. You might miss hidden water.
Water on the floor that won’t go away No Yes It could mean a broken pipe or a leak. You need professional help to find and fix the issue.
Mold growing in the bathroom No Yes Mold is a health hazard and hard to remove. Professionals have the tools and training to handle it.
Water under the toilet or on the walls No Yes It could mean a serious leak. You need to act fast to prevent more damage.
Standing water in the bathroom No Yes It’s a sign of a major problem. You need to call a professional to fix it before it spreads.
Unusual smells or sounds from the toilet No Yes These could mean a blockage or a leak. Professionals have the tools to find and fix the issue.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Initial Assessment $100 – $250 Time of day, complexity of the issue, and location in Efland, NC
Water Extraction $200 – $500 Amount of water, floor type, and access to the area
Drying and Dehumidification $300 – $1,000 Size of the area, humidity levels, and number of days needed
Sanitization and Disinfection $150 – $400 Level of contamination and type of surfaces
Restoration and Repairs $500 – $2,500 Extent of damage, materials needed, and labor required
Final Inspection $100 – $200 Time required and complexity of the job
